How they compare
Iran currently reports 5.9% against 5.8% in United States,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was United States ahead.
Iran ranks 100th and United States ranks 103rd of 218 countries.
United States has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Iran | United States |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 3.0% | 5.4% | 2.4% | United States |
| 1970s | 3.3% | 5.5% | 2.2% | United States |
| 1980s | 3.1% | 4.8% | 1.7% | United States |
| 1990s | 2.9% | 5.3% | 2.4% | United States |
| 2000s | 3.9% | 6.8% | 2.9% | United States |
| 2010s | 4.8% | 6.9% | 2.1% | United States |
| 2020s | 5.6% | 6.0% | 0.4% | United States |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
